Data transmission method, apparatus, equipment and system for direct communication

The present invention discloses a data transmission method, apparatus, equipment and system for direct connection communication, which belongs to the technical field of communication. The method comprises the steps of sending direct connection data to a second terminal through a direct connection link according to the DCI sent by an access network device by a first terminal; receiving the HARQ feedback information of the direct connection hybrid automatic retransmission request fed back by the second terminal, wherein the direct connection HARQ feedback information is used to indicate the receiving state corresponding to the direct connection data; and reporting the direct connection HARQ feedback information to the access network device. In this way, in the direct connection communicationscenario based on the access network equipment scheduling, the direct connection HARQ feedback information may be directly transmitted from the second terminal to the first terminal, and then reported by the first terminal to the access network device to ensure the success rate of information transmission and reception in the direct connection communication scenario, and improve the efficiency ofdata transmission.

Method and system for locating partial discharge of electrical equipment

A method for locating partial discharge of electrical equipment is used for detecting and locating partial discharge of the electrical equipment. The technical scheme includes the steps: firstly, using three ultrasonic array sensors to receive partial discharge ultrasonic signals at different positions of the electrical equipment and forming an array model; then, converting broadband signals received by the three ultrasonic array sensors into narrow-band signals by applying a TLS (transport layer security)-based broadband focus algorithm, and obtaining azimuth information of partial discharge sources according to a narrow-band direction-finding algorithm combining the phase matching principle and cloud optimization search; and finally, determining specific positions of electrical equipment partial discharge by means of a partial discharge source location algorithm based on global optimization search of a modified genetic algorithm. The invention simultaneously provides an improved system for locating partial discharge. Compared with a traditional method for locating partial discharge, the method has the advantages of small calculation amount, high direction-finding precision, accuracy in location, high convergence rate and the like, and the system for locating partial discharge is simple in structure, low in cost and high in location precision.

Method for controlling transport robot to autonomously enter elevator

The invention discloses a method for controlling a transport robot to autonomously enter an elevator. The method for controlling the transport robot to autonomously enter the elevator comprises the following steps of navigating the robot to a doorway of the elevator by utilizing an own navigation device of the robot, before the robot enters the elevator, obtaining the position of an elevator call button by utilizing a robot vehicular vision module with depth information collection, triggering the elevator call button according to the position information of the elevator call button, and calling the elevator; obtaining the state information of an elevator door by utilizing a retreating sensor module, and controlling the robot to enter the elevator. According to the method for controlling the transport robot to autonomously enter the elevator, through combining with signals obtained by a Kinect sensor and the retreating sensor module, the past way that an instruction is sent to an elevator controller by a remote control center is thoroughly changed; the past way is changed into the way that an instruction is sent to the robot by the remote control center, the instruction is sent to a PLC (Programmable Logic Controller) by a robot vehicular controller and the elevator is triggered through an arm of the robot; by combining with the redundant design of a full load judgment condition module in the elevator, the control safety performance of the elevator is promoted.

Automatic butt assembling method for large part as well as system

The invention discloses an automatic butt assembling method for a large part as well as a system. The method comprises steps as follows: kinematic parameters of a servo posture adjusting positioner under the loading condition are calibrated firstly, an actual mathematical model of a butt part is established according to measurement data of the butt part, the butt part is corrected or reworked through comparison of the actual mathematical model and an ideal mathematical model of the butt part, then the relative position between a butt feature point of the butt part and a support measurement point arranged on a support device is calibrated, the butt part is mounted on the servo posture adjusting positioner, the position of the butt part in an overall reference coordinate system is determined, then a path of the butt part is planned with the optimum matching algorithm, the driving amount of each shaft of the servo posture adjusting positioner is obtained through inverse solution, finally, the butt part is moved by the servo posture adjusting positioner, and butt assembly of the butt part is completed. According to the automatic butt assembling method for the large part as well as the system, transfer errors are reduced, and errors caused by utilization of the ideal mathematical model or non-measurable property of the butt feature point are avoided, so that the quality and the success rate of automatic assembly are guaranteed.

Rapid ambiguity determination method among network RTK reference stations of big-dipper three-frequency signal

The invention discloses a rapid ambiguity determination method among network RTK reference stations of a big-dipper three-frequency signal. The method is characterized by firstly, rapidly determining a big-dipper super-wide lane ambiguity; then, using two carrier-wave-phase non-ionosphere combination observation values and the super-wide lane ambiguity to determine a wide lane ambiguity; and then, using Kalman filtering to calculate zenith troposphere delay correction between the phase non-ionosphere combination observation values and the reference stations; and finally, fixing an original ambiguity. The method comprises the following steps of (1) fixing the super-wide lane ambiguity and the wide lane ambiguity; (2) according to the Kalman filtering, estimating two-reference-station zenith troposphere delay and ambiguity floating point solutions of two groups of phase non-ionosphere observation values; and (3) according to a non-ionosphere combination ambiguity and the wide lane ambiguity, fixing the original ambiguity. In the invention, an advantage of the big-dipper three-frequency signal is fully used and the Kalman filtering is combined so as to realize rapid and accurate fixation of the ambiguity among big dipper network RTK three-frequency reference stations.

Polyester elastomer/PET composite elastic fiber and preparation method thereof

The invention discloses a polyester elastomer / PET composite elastic fiber and a preparation method thereof. The preparation method comprises the steps of firstly carrying out reduced-pressure direct esterification on terephthalic acid, 1,4-butanediol and double-ended hydroxyl polyether in a certain proportion in the presence of catalysts, carrying out melt polycondensation to obtain a polyester elastomer, and carrying out a spin-draw-winding one-step process on the prepared polyester elastomer and PET, so as to obtain the polyester elastomer / PET composite elastic fiber, wherein the breaking strength of the polyester elastomer / PET composite elastic fiber is 2.8cN / dtex-3.56cN / dtex, the elongation at break is 16.9%-30.4%, the curling degree is 60%-75%, the curling elasticity rate is 97%-99%, the capillary water absorption height is 9.7cm / 30min-14.1cm / 30min. Compared with normal composite elastic fibers, the polyester elastomer / PET composite elastic fiber has relatively excellent elasticity and relatively soft hand feeling, and the fabric capillary suction effect of the polyester elastomer / PET composite elastic fiber is even higher than those of cotton fabrics; the preparation method is short in production process, high in spinning speed and low in cost, and the prepared composite elastic fiber can be directly used in subsequent weaving without being processed into interlaced yarns.

Method with effects of saving cost and improving efficiency for liquid pollination of pear tree

The invention provides a method with effects of saving cost and improving efficiency for liquid pollination of pear tree, which belongs to the fruit trees production technical field. The method comprises the following steps: preparing a nutrient solution in full-bloom stage of pear flowers, adding 0.8g pure pollen in every liter of nutrient solution, spraying and pollinating by an electrostatic sprayer to achieve the purpose of artificial pollination. The pollination method has the advantages of simple operation, fast pollination speed, uniform powder injection, concentration, accuracy, pollen and manual work saving, low cost and the like, and solves the practical problems that pollen can not be uniformly dissolved in water in liquid pollination of fruit trees, pollen is easy to adhere with the wall of a container, pollen is obstructed a nozzle, uneven powder injection causes poor pollination effect and the real application of liquid pollination can not be realized for a long time. According to the invention, the new collected pure pollen (germination rate is 60%-80%) in current year required by per mu is 8-11g. In addition, the method of the invention is capable of increasing the moisture and nutrient of pistil stigma and prolonging the fecundation time of stigma pollination, and the fruit quality can not be affected by increasing the fruit setting rate.

Orientation positioning seeder

The invention discloses an orientation positioning seeder. The orientation positioning seeder comprises a workbench, a conveying device, an aperture disk, an aperture pressing mechanism, an oriented seed aperture device, a negative pressure seed discharge device, a sprinkling device, a guide rod, a position sensor and a control case. The workbench comprises a frame and a workbench surface. The conveying device is installed on the workbench surface and is used for conveying the aperture disk according to a flow line working process so that the aperture disk goes through the aperture pressing mechanism, the oriented seed aperture device, the negative pressure seed discharge device and the sprinkling device, PLC is used for controlling the whole seeder, the oriented seed aperture device adopting a machine vision technology realizes seed direction adjustment, the negative pressure seed discharge device carries out orientation positioning sowing on the seeds subjected to direction adjustment, the sprinkling device is used for watering the apertures with the seeds, and the position sensor is used for accurately detecting and feeding back the work process. The orientation positioning seeder realizes 45 degree orientation positioning sowing of large seeds. The orientation positioning seeder solves the problem that the manual sowing method has low work efficiency and causes fatigue easily, can cultivate standard seedlings and provides favorable conditions for automatic grafting implementation.

Distributed collaborative multiple access method and system thereof

The invention relates to a distributed collaborative multiple access method and a system thereof, the method comprises the steps that: according to a stored and maintained collaboration list, a source node selects two candidate nodes used for collaboration, sets a priority level and then sends out a CRTS grouping, and the CRTS grouping comprises the addresses and the priority level of the two candidate nodes; a destination node receives the CRTS grouping, calculates the highest channel speed supported between a source node and the destination node, and sets the channel speed into a CCTS grouping for feedback to the source node; after the CRTS grouping and the CCTS grouping are monitored, whether the two candidate nodes meet the collaborative condition is met is judged, and the candidate node meeting the collaborative condition is taken as a collaborative node and sent into a RTH grouping according to the preset priority policy; and according to the RTH grouping, the source node sends a data grouping to the destination node. By selecting the two candidate nodes and setting the priority level, the invention not only effectively shortens the time in competitive stage, but also effectively avoids competitive conflict and saves the channel resource.
